Overview

Meet and feed friendly alpacas with Rustic Retreats near Matlock, where countryside charm meets hands-on wildlife interaction. A perfect day out for all ages against the stunning Peak District backdrop.

Adventure Tips

Wear sturdy, closed-toe footwear

Fields can be muddy or uneven, so sensible shoes ensure comfort while interacting with alpacas.

Arrive 15 minutes early

Allow time for check-in and a safety briefing before meeting the alpacas to fully enjoy your visit.

Hands-on feeding included

Bring an open mind and enjoy feeding the alpacas carrots, provided at no extra cost during the visit.

No dogs or smoking onsite

To keep the environment safe and pleasant for animals and guests, dogs and smoking are prohibited.

History

Carsington Water was created in the 1990s as a reservoir to provide drinking water and now supports diverse recreational activities in the Peak District.
